Wall Mounted Electric Fireplaces
In contrast to a freestanding fireplace wall-mounted units can be put in nearly any room. They are also easy to install as they don't require framing any openings or install vent pipes.
Choose a model that offers multiple surround options and a variety of fire glass colors. You should also take into consideration the color of the flames and the heat and brightness settings.
Aesthetics
Although a wall-mounted electric fire fireplace is a great option for homeowners looking to add warmth to their homes Additionally, they can be an aesthetic element that will blend in well with any style of décor. You can pick from a range of finishes and colors and between an open-flame look or a realistic log-effect.
The color of the surround on the wall-mounted electric fireplace is crucial, as it will impact the overall appearance of the fireplace. Modern models have different surrounds such as white fireplace, black, and silver. Some models are built to match your home's walls. The size of a wall hung electric fireplace is a further aspect to take into consideration. A bigger model is suited for a large room, while a compact one is ideal for a smaller area.
A standard wall-mounted electric fireplace has an energy output of 1 to 2 kW, fireplaces fireplace which can comfortably warm up most rooms in a typical home in Toronto. However, if you have an area that is larger you might want to consider getting an additional heater to ensure it is adequately heated.

Installation
A fireplace that is mounted on the wall is a great option to create a cozy atmosphere without taking up the floor space. They're easy to set up and look great in almost any space. It's important that you carefully follow the directions of the manufacturer prior to starting the project. You should also have a second person assist you in installing the fireplace. This will ensure that everything runs smoothly and that your fireplace is properly mounted.
If you're thinking about installing an electric fireplace on your wall it is recommended to eliminate any combustible materials from the area. This includes curtains, pillows, and other furniture. As a rule, keep curtains and other furniture at least 1.5 feet from the fireplace's edges. This will ensure that your flames are safe and also prevent them from damaging your curtains or walls.
It's also important to choose the best location for your fireplace. It should be located near an electrical outlet, but not directly underneath anything that could be damaged. For instance, don't place a fireplace underneath a television, as the heat will damage it. You should also test the fireplace prior to putting it in place. it. Plug it in and play with the lights and heat settings to ensure they work correctly.
Unlike gas fires, wall-mounted electric fires don't require venting, so you can install them on a wall that is solid. The electric fires are also more affordable to install and purchase and don't require annual maintenance checks as do gas fires. They're also less likely to cause carbon monoxide leaks.
